Start from: The Engagement dashboard.
- Navigate to Chat > Chat overview.
- Select the Summary period control and choose the timeframe you want to review.
The period applies to every widget on the screen, so all figures and comparisons cover the same timeframe.

Review chat types

Chat types shows the formats in use across the organisation during the selected period.
- Active group chats: the total number of active group chats. Select Active group chats to open the group chats area and review activity in detail.
- Peer to peer chats: the total number of active one-to-one conversations between employees.
Comparing the two figures shows the balance between group collaboration and direct communication.
Review message volume and moderation

Messages covers message volume and flagged content.
- Messages sent: the total number of messages sent during the period.
- Reported messages: the number of messages flagged by users. Select Reported messages to open the reported messages area, where flagged content can be reviewed and managed.
Note: monitoring reported messages helps maintain a safe and appropriate communication environment. A rise in this figure is worth investigating promptly.
Review the engagement rate

Engagement rate measures how actively users take part in chats, based on messages, interactions and active participation during the selected period. It is based on participation rather than chat membership, so it reflects genuine use rather than how many people have been added to a chat.
- Active users: shown as a ratio against the total number of users with access to chat.
- Engaged users: the number of active users who actually sent messages. Select the information icon beside the label to see this definition in the interface.
- The donut chart shows the overall engagement percentage for the period.
Understanding the trend indicators
Most figures on this screen carry a trend indicator comparing the selected period with the previous one. An upward green indicator shows an increase and a downward red indicator shows a decrease.
Notes: for Reported messages, a downward indicator means fewer messages were flagged than in the previous period.
